Raf Magar is a scholar working on Neurology, Surgery and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Raf Magar has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 448 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Neurology, 4 papers in Surgery and 4 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Raf Magar’s work include Botulinum Toxin and Related Neurological Disorders (7 papers), Neurological disorders and treatments (5 papers) and Gastrointestinal motility and disorders (3 papers). Raf Magar is often cited by papers focused on Botulinum Toxin and Related Neurological Disorders (7 papers), Neurological disorders and treatments (5 papers) and Gastrointestinal motility and disorders (3 papers). Raf Magar coll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Switzerland. Raf Magar's co-authors include Albert Marchetti, Helen Lau, Allen B. King, John P. Martin, Leann Olansky, Patrick J. Boyle, Liping Wang, Allison Brashear, Jan Larsen and Robert Jech and has published in prestigious journals such as Neurology, Movement Disorders and Toxicon.
